Overview
The Baltimore Ravens advanced to the second round of the AFC playoffs with a dominant 28-14 victory over the Pittsburgh Steelers. Derrick Henry rushed for 186 yards and scored twice, while Lamar Jackson threw for two touchdowns and added 81 rushing yards. The Ravens set a playoff record by outrushing the Steelers 299-29, emphasizing their powerful ground game. The victory secures a matchup against either Buffalo or Houston next week, while the Steelers conclude their season with a disappointing fifth straight loss.
